Abstract

A data storage device is disclosed comprising a non-volatile storage medium (NVSM). A reliability metric for each symbol of each of a plurality of codewords read from the NVSM is generated, and a number of erasures for a first codeword are generated, wherein the number of erasures exceeds the correction power of the first codeword. A reliability metric of the first codeword is modified corresponding to one of the erasures. The reliability metrics for each codeword including the modified reliability metrics of the first codeword are first iteratively processed using a low density parity check (LDPC) type decoder, thereby first updating the reliability metric for each symbol of each codeword. The reliability metrics for the first codeword are second updated using the parity sector, and the second updated reliability metrics for the first codeword are second iteratively processed using the LDPC-type decoder.
